The Lead Designer is responsible for bringing our brand to life through compelling, cohesive visual design across digital, print, and web platforms. This role owns the creative execution of omnichannel marketing campaigns, develops and maintains brand standards, and creates scalable design systems that support both corporate and school-level needs. The Lead Designer will partner with cross-functional teams to deliver creative assets that uphold brand standards, enhance the consumer journey, and meaningfully increase engagement and growth.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Own and evolve brand guidelines, ensuring consistent use of color, typography, imagery, logos, and design components across all marketing and communication channels.
  • Design high-impact creative assets including paid ads, social content, print collateral, email templates, website layouts, presentations, and other marketing materials that drive engagement and enrollment.
  • Lead end-to-end design projects, from concept through delivery, ensuring high-quality execution, on-time delivery, and alignment with strategic goals and brand standards.
  •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including Marketing, Enrollment, Operations, and external agencies, to develop cohesive, innovative campaigns that strengthen brand presence and support community engagement.
  • Develop scalable design solutions, including customizable templates for schools, enabling quick-turn, high-volume content creation while preserving brand consistency.
  • Manage and update website content (WordPress), applying best practices in UX, responsive design, accessibility, SEO-friendly formatting, and digital brand presentation.
  • Produce and edit video content, incorporating motion graphics and light animation to support storytelling and marketing initiatives.
  • Stay current on design trends and emerging tools, applying new insights to enhance creativity, improve user experience, and maintain a competitive edge.

Experience and Education: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Graphic Design, Visual Communications, or related field.
  • 5+ years of professional design experience, preferably in omnichannel marketing or consumer-focused industries.
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ign), Figma or similar design tools.
  • Knowledge of digital ad specs and responsive web design.
  • Experience creating scalable design systems and templates; familiarity with healthcare or education marketing is a plus.
  • Experience with WordPress for content updates and basic site maintenance.
  • Proficiency in video editing software (e.g., Adobe Premiere Pro, After Effects) and light animation techniques.

Job Competencies

  • Strong conceptual thinking and attention to detail
  • Ability to manage multiple projects under tight deadlines
  • Excellent communication skills.
